A month long inter-club players’ transfer of the Professional Football League (Bangladesh Premier League) for the upcoming season begins today at the Bangladesh Football Federation Bhaban.
Although the official formalities is to begin from today but almost all the teams have already confirmed the services of the players of their choices.
This season the players’ transfer got some excitement when the Chittagong Abahani Limited, one of the bottom sides of the league table came forward to form a strong team to compete for the league championship.
Meanwhile, after Mamunul Islam expressing his desire to play for the Ctg Abahani and his Sheikh Jamal colleagues Nasiruddin Chowdhury, Sohel Rana, Rayhan Hassan and Yamin Munna almost confirmed for the Port City club.
On the other hands, some of the premier performers, Jamal Bhuiyan, Monayem Khan Raju, Shakhawat Hossain Rony and Alamgir Rana, who played for Jamal in the previous season, expected to play for Sheikh Russel Krira Chakra, as they left the BFF Bhaban on January 19 accompanied with some of Russel’s officials.
